Understanding Palliative Care and Hospice Care

Palliative care and hospice care are two distinct yet interconnected approaches to providing comprehensive care for individuals with serious illnesses. While they share similarities in their goals of improving the quality of life for patients, there are key differences between the two.

Differentiating Palliative Care and Hospice Care

Palliative care is a specialized medical care approach that focuses on providing relief from the symptoms, pain, and stress associated with a serious illness. It can be provided at any stage of the illness, regardless of the prognosis. Palliative care aims to improve the overall well-being of patients by addressing their physical, emotional, and spiritual needs.

Hospice care, on the other hand, is a form of palliative care specifically designed for individuals who have a terminal illness with a prognosis of six months or less to live. Hospice care is typically provided in the final stages of life and focuses on ensuring comfort and dignity for patients during this time. It involves a multidisciplinary team that provides medical, emotional, and spiritual support to both the patient and their family.

When to Consider Palliative Care and Hospice Care

Determining when to consider palliative care or hospice care is an important decision that depends on various factors. Understanding these factors can help individuals and their loved ones make informed choices about the appropriate care options. Let's explore the determining factors for both palliative care and hospice care.

Determining Factors for Palliative Care

Palliative care is designed to provide comprehensive support and symptom management for individuals dealing with serious illnesses. It can be considered at any stage of the illness and can be provided alongside curative treatments. Some determining factors for considering palliative care include:

  1. Diagnosis of a Serious Illness: Palliative care is often appropriate for individuals diagnosed with serious conditions such as cancer, heart disease, respiratory disease, or neurological disorders.
  2. Pain and Symptom Management: If the individual is experiencing pain, discomfort, or other distressing symptoms related to their illness or treatment, palliative care can help alleviate these symptoms and improve their quality of life.
  3. Complex Care Needs: Palliative care is beneficial for individuals with complex care needs that require coordination and management across multiple healthcare providers. This can include assistance with medication management, care planning, and coordination of various treatments and therapies.
  4. Emotional and Psychosocial Support: Palliative care can provide emotional and psychosocial support not only to the individual but also to their family members. It focuses on addressing the emotional and psychological impact of the illness on all involved.

Determining Factors for Hospice Care

Hospice care, on the other hand, is specifically intended for individuals nearing the end of life. It focuses on providing comfort, support, and dignity to individuals in their final stages of a terminal illness. Some determining factors for considering hospice care include:

  1. Prognosis of a Terminal Illness: Hospice care is appropriate when an individual has a prognosis of six months or less to live, as determined by their healthcare provider.
  2. Shift in Treatment Goals: When curative treatments are no longer effective or desired, and the focus shifts towards maximizing comfort and quality of life, hospice care becomes an important consideration.
  3. Managing End-of-Life Symptoms: Hospice care specializes in managing end-of-life symptoms, such as pain, shortness of breath, nausea, and anxiety. It provides specialized care to ensure a peaceful and comfortable end-of-life experience.
  4. End-of-Life Planning and Support: Hospice care offers support for individuals and their families during the emotional and practical aspects of end-of-life planning, including advance care planning, bereavement support, and assistance with funeral arrangements.

Collaborative Care Planning and Implementation

Collaborative care planning and implementation are essential components of palliative and hospice care. These processes involve the coordination of services and the development of an individualized care plan based on the patient's goals and preferences. Here are some key aspects of collaborative care planning and implementation:

  1. Assessment: The interdisciplinary team conducts a comprehensive assessment of the patient's physical, emotional, and spiritual needs, along with their goals and values. This assessment guides the development of the care plan.
  2. Care Plan Development: Based on the assessment, the interdisciplinary team collaborates to create a personalized care plan that addresses the patient's goals, symptom management, psychosocial support, and spiritual care.
  3. Regular Team Meetings: The team holds regular meetings to discuss the patient's progress, review the effectiveness of the care plan, and make necessary adjustments to ensure that it remains aligned with the patient's evolving needs and goals.
  4. Communication and Coordination: Effective communication and coordination among team members are crucial to ensure seamless care transitions, timely interventions, and the provision of holistic support. This includes sharing updates, discussing treatment options, and addressing any challenges that may arise.
  5. Patient and Family Involvement: The patient and their family are actively involved in the care planning and decision-making process. Their input is valuable in tailoring the care plan to their preferences and ensuring that their goals and values are respected.
